在深入了解匹配算法之前,我们首先需要明确匹配算法的设计目标。在多人在线竞技游戏中,公平性与玩家体验是匹配算法设计的两大核心原则。尤其是对于金铲铲之战这样的策略游戏,匹配算法需要确保每位玩家能够与水平相近的对手进行比赛,从而保证比赛的激烈与公正,同时也让玩家感受到进步与挑战。
手游金铲铲之战的匹配算法采用了一种多层级的分层匹配机制。这种机制的基本思想是将所有在线的玩家根据他们的游戏技能等级(例如胜率、排名等)分成不同的层级,然后在相应的层级内进行匹配。这种方法不仅可以缩短玩家的等待时间,还可以确保玩家间的竞赛尽可能公平。
玩家评级:游戏系统会根据玩家过去的表现给予一个初始评级,这个评级决定了玩家在匹配系统中的位置。
快速筛选:在玩家进入匹配队列后,系统首先尝试在同一评级的玩家中进行快速匹配。
等待时间调整:如果在一定时间内没有找到合适的对手,系统会逐渐扩大搜索范围,允许与略高或略低评级的玩家匹配,以缩短玩家的等待时间。
最终匹配:一旦找到合适的对手,系统则完成匹配,游戏即刻开始。
匹配算法的设计并不是一成不变的。随着游戏的发展和玩家数量的增加,金铲铲之战的匹配算法也在不断进行优化和调整。算法需要不断调整,以适应不同的玩家群体和竞赛环境。另维持匹配的速度和质量,平衡玩家的等待时间和比赛的公平性,也是算法设计中的一个重要挑战。
金铲铲之战的开发团队非常重视玩家的反馈。通过分析玩家的投诉和建议,团队能够更好地理解匹配系统的问题所在,并据此进行调整。通过大数据分析,团队能够实时监控匹配算法的表现,及时发现并解决问题,确保匹配系统能够适应游戏的发展和玩家需求的变化。
手游金铲铲之战的匹配算法设计精巧,不仅考虑到了匹配的效率和公平性,而且通过持续的优化和迭代,努力提升玩家的游戏体验。虽然匹配算法仍然面临着诸多挑战,但通过技术的进步和团队的努力,相信未来金铲铲之战能够为玩家提供更加优质和公平的比赛环境。对于其他游戏开发者来说,金铲铲之战的匹配算法提供了一个值得学习和借鉴的案例,展示了如何通过技术创新来不断提升玩家的游戏体验和满意度。